Necromancer: The Beginner's Best Friend
The Necromancer continues to hold strong as perhaps the best starter class for solo players in 2025. With your army of skeletons providing constant support, you'll have a more forgiving experience while learning the game's mechanics.
Key advantages for beginners:
-
Your skeleton minions tank damage and fight for you
-
Strong survivability through life-stealing abilities
-
Powerful area-of-effect damage options
-
Relatively straightforward resource management once you understand corpses
The only real downside for newcomers is managing two resources (Essence and Corpses), but this becomes intuitive after a few hours of gameplay. The Book of the Dead mechanic also allows for customizing your undead army to suit your preferred playstyle.
Barbarian: Simple Yet Effective
If you prefer a more straightforward, in-your-face approach, the Barbarian makes an excellent 10 starter class choice. While slightly more challenging in the early game, Barbarians scale exceptionally well into endgame content.
Why choose Barbarian:
-
Straightforward melee combat mechanics
-
Exceptional survivability with defensive shouts and abilities
-
Top-tier endgame scaling with the unique Weapon Arsenal system
-
Powerful mobility options for navigating the battlefield
The learning curve comes from mastering weapon switching and surviving early content before you've acquired solid defensive gear. However, builds like Whirlwind and Earthquake remain among the most powerful in the current season.

Rogue: The Solo Specialist
For skilled players seeking a challenge, the Rogue offers unmatched versatility and mobility. In 2025's meta, Rogue builds have been refined to offer exceptional single-target damage against bosses while maintaining solid area clearing capabilities.
The Specialization mechanic allows you to adapt to different content types, making this an excellent choice for experienced players who enjoy switching tactics. Death Trap builds continue to dominate the meta, though Blizzard has introduced more viable alternatives in recent patches.
Druid: The Balanced Option
The Druid has finally found its place in the 2025 meta after several balance adjustments. Offering a mix of shapeshifting, elemental damage, and companion summons, this class provides a well-rounded experience for solo players.
While historically slower for leveling, recent quality-of-life improvements have addressed this weakness. The Spirit Animal system gives you flexibility to adapt your playstyle as you learn the game.
Starter Guide for Complete Beginners
If you're completely new to Diablo 4, here's a quick starter guide regardless of which class you choose:
-
Focus on the campaign first - This will teach you core mechanics while providing decent gear
-
Don't worry about perfect builds early - Experiment with different skills to find what feels comfortable
-
Understand your class resource - Each class has unique resources that power their abilities
-
Prioritize survivability - It's better to stay alive longer than to maximize damage initially
-
Join the seasonal journey - Seasonal content provides excellent rewards and progression paths
